The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.
In the 1881 Census, the household of Andrew Gibb, born in 1850 in Midlothian, consisted of 7 members. Andrew was the head of the household, married to Margaret Gibb, born in 1848 in Hamilton, Lanarkshire, Scotland. They had 3 children; Henry (born 1876 in Rutherglen, Lanarkshire, Scotland), Margaret (born 1878 in Rutherglen, Lanarkshire, Scotland) and Agnes (born 1881 in Rutherglen, Lanarkshire, Scotland).
During the period, also present in the household were Andrew's Boarder, William (born 1857 in Dumfriesshire, Scotland) and Andrew's Boarder, William (born 1858 in England).
